About the Role

As our next Associate Inside Sales Representative, you will be the face and voice of Aurora Consumer. You’ll engage with potential customers, assess their property’s suitability for solar installation, and guide them through an exciting journey toward energy independence. In this role, you’ll not only educate prospects on the benefits of solar energy but also become a trusted advisor throughout their decision-making process. You’ll be the primary liaison between our customers and local solar installer partners, ensuring a smooth and rewarding experience for everyone involved. This role is on-site in Lehi, UT.


Your Impact  

  • Deliver compelling virtual sales presentations via Zoom, clearly demonstrating the value of solar energy and addressing customer inquiries with confidence

  • Evaluate property suitability for solar installation by asking targeted questions and providing expert guidance to ensure a seamless customer journey

  • Efficiently manage all required sales documents using Aurora’s proprietary software, ensuring compliance and a smooth sales process

  • Cultivate long-lasting relationships by following up on leads, nurturing referral opportunities, and consistently providing exceptional customer service

  • Serve as the key contact between consumers and our local solar installer partners, fostering strong collaborations that drive successful installations

  • Represent and embody the Aurora Solar Vision and Mission, championing our commitment to a sustainable energy future

What You Bring

  • Comfortable using MS Office, G Suite, CRMs, and virtual sales platforms to drive productivity and enhance customer interactions

  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ills to effectively connect with diverse customers and team members

  • Exceptional attention to detail and proactive follow-up skills to keep the sales process running smoothly

  • A flexible approach with the ability to work some evenings and weekends as needed

  • A results-driven, self-directed individual eager to learn, grow, and contribute in a dynamic environment

  • Prior inside sales and solar industry experience

Nice to Haves

  • Bilingual proficiency in Spanish to effectively serve a diverse customer base

  • Familiarity with digital marketing concepts to complement your sales expertise

What you need to know about the Los Angeles Tech Scene

Los Angeles is a global leader in entertainment, so it’s no surprise that many of the biggest players in streaming, digital media and game development call the city home. But the city boasts plenty of non-entertainment innovation as well, with tech companies spanning verticals like AI, fintech, e-commerce and biotech. With major universities like Caltech, UCLA, USC and the nearby UC Irvine, the city has a steady supply of top-flight tech and engineering talent — not counting the graduates flocking to Los Angeles from across the world to enjoy its beaches, culture and year-round temperate climate.

Key Facts About Los Angeles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 375,800; 5.5%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Snap, Netflix, SpaceX, Disney, Google
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, adtech, media, software, game development
  • Funding Landscape: $11.6 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Strong Ventures, Fifth Wall, Upfront Ventures, Mucker Capital, Kittyhawk Ventures
  • Research Centers and Universities: California Institute of Technology, UCLA, University of Southern California, UC Irvine, Pepperdine, California Institute for Immunology and Immunotherapy, Center for Quantum Science and Engineering
